Whoever Writes the Semantic Layer Wears the Crown

Semantic layer ownership in organizations is framed as a political problem, not a technical one. Most enterprises have no named owner for core business metric definitions — pipelines are maintained, dashboards are consumed, but meaning is ungoverned. When AI agents query ungoverned semantic layers, they confidently repeat whichever definition was encoded by default, typically by a platform team with no business accountability. The proposed fix: pair a named business owner accountable for what a metric means with a technical counterpart who implements it, and wrap both in a formal change process so that altering a definition is a deliberate decision rather than a file edit.
